Installer SQL Server sur Docker
Installer SQL Server sur Docker.
Pour ces opérations, je vais utiliser Podman à la place de Docker sur ma machine Debian, afin de profiter d’une installation serviceless et qui n’a pas besoin de fonctionner en mode root.
Récupération de l’image Docker de SQL Server
Vous pouvez trouver la liste des images téléchargeables ici.
Vous pouvez spécifier l’édition dans les variables d’environnement, Avec la variable MSSQL_PID. Par exemple -e "MSSQL_PID=Developer" pour l’édition Developer.
podman pull mcr.microsoft.com/mssql/server:2022-latest
podman run -e "ACCEPT_EULA=Y" -e "SA_PASSWORD=Admin12345!" -e "MSSQL_PID=Developer" -p 1433:1433 --name sql_server_2022 -d mcr.microsoft.com/mssql/server:2022-latest
Vérifiez que le conteneur fonctionne correctement avec la commande :
podman ls
Obtenir un certificat SSL avec Certbot
sudo certbot certonly --standalone --preferred-challenges http -d sql.pachadata.com